The support group for immigrants who left Russia due to the war against Ukraine.

Since the beginning of the war, hundreds of thousands of Russians have left the country. Many just quit with no clear plan, savings, or job. The Anti-War Committee has created a Support Group for Russian Emigrants who condemn the military aggression against Ukraine and see no opportunity for themselves to live in Putin’s Russia. The Ark provides free accommodation in Yerevan and Istanbul and consultancy regarding documents and orientation services. Free consultations are available in other countries.

What can the Ark do for you?

  • Provide accommodation for the initial period.

  • Consult on obtaining documents for residence, opening bank accounts, and visas.

  • Consult legal questions.

  • Meet and connect you with other immigrants.

  • Provide psychological help.

Humanitarian aid for Ukraine

On February 24, 2022, the life of every Ukrainian changed forever. At this moment, thousands of people are hiding from the Russian army’s shelling, fearing to go outside, starving, and struggling to find the medications they need. Cities in the war zone have been cut off from regular supply chains.

One day, the war will end, and Ukraine will be rebuilt. But to survive this nightmare, people need humanitarian aid — food, water, medicine, clothing, and hygiene items.

The Russian Anti-War Committee has partnered with major European suppliers for wholesale deliveries of food, medicine, and other goods to Ukraine.

We purchase humanitarian aid and organize its delivery to Lviv, where it is picked up by our trusted partners from local NGOs.

They distribute it to agreed locations in Ukraine that are in the greatest need of humanitarian aid.

We track every step and publish delivery reports on the Anti-War Committee’s website.
